SERVICES PROVIDED TO CITIZENS BY DELHI GOVERNMENT- GOVERNMENT OF NATIONAL CAPITAL TERRITORY OF DELHI
System Requirement Analysis
What is System Analysis?
Systems analysis is the study of sets of interacting entities, including computer systems analysis. This field is closely related to requirements analysis or operations research. It is also "an explicit formal inquiry carried out to help someone (referred to as the decision maker) identify a better course of action and make a better decision than he might otherwise have made."
2.1 System Overview:
The project “SERVICES PROVIDED TO CITIZENS BY DELHI GOVERNMENT” aims at making all government services accessible to the common man in his locality, throughout common service delivery outlets and ensures efficiency, transparency & reliability of such services at affordable costs to realize the basic needs of the common man.
This website would assist the Delhi government to improve the standard of information and service delivery through the electronic media and demonstrate its commitment to enhance government citizen interaction through application of internet technologies. This website will do marriage registration and ration and voting card registration for citizens. It also generates online electricity and telephone bills. It even allows citizens to post their complaints and suggestions online.

WORKING OF SYSTEM:
This website provides the following services and each service is performed in a separate module:
1. Login Process
The system maintains the ID and Password of the administrator who is supposed to operate the system. This process carried out by the administrator of the information system when he operates his own account in the system. Under this the administrator uploads forms for registration, adds/Updates details related to telephone and electricity bills, Adds/updates details related to citizen information guide. He also views the grievances or complaints of the Citizens.
2. Registration Process
In the registration process, user is presented with two choices: New, and Add/Update.
All Entities must select "New" the first time they register at this site. Choose "Add/Update"
to make changes to an existing registration entered.
i. Registration for marriages: This module provides online registration of marriages. A marriage which has already been solemnized can be registered either under the Hindu Marriage Act, 1955 or under the Special Marriage Act, 1954. The Hindu Marriage Act is applicable in cases where both husband and wife are Hindus, Buddhists, Jains or Sikhs or where they have converted into any of these religions. Where either of the husband or wife or both are not Hindus, Buddhists, Jains or Sikhs, the marriage is registered under the Special Marriage Act, 1954.
ii. Registration of Ration Card and Voting Card: This module provides online registration of ration card and voting card. Ration card is a very important nationality as well as identity proof. Besides, it also provides the right to purchase goods from rationing shops. One thing that has much importance as to prove identity in India is voter ID card issued to adults by the election commission. Usually voter’s ID card is issued to adults after cross verification on local level.
3. View Registration Details Process: In this process, the user is provided with the View option. He can view the contents of the registration database or download the database details to his local computer.
4. Bill Details View process: Bill Pay Service provides view of bills on the screen and STD/ISD details. It is a free, fast and secure way to view and get electricity and MTNL telephone bills.
i. View electricity bill: This module allows user to view electricity bills.
ii. View telephone bill: This module allows user to view telephone bills.
5. Citizen information guide: A citizen information guide is provided in this module where the citizens can view information regarding travel and tourism, employment and business, senior citizen corner, taxes and finance, law and order , and housing, etc
6. Bill Details Update Process: In this process the administrator will enter and update the details of consumer.
7. Public grievances: The Public Grievances Commission administers a comprehensive mechanism for the effective redressal of grievances received from members of the public. Incoming grievances / complaints are directed against the different departments under the jurisdiction of the Government of the National Capital Territory (NCT) of Delhi, its local bodies, undertakings / other organizations, owned or substantially financed by the Government of Delhi. Delhi Police has also been brought under the Commission. In the exercise of its functions, the PGC has the same measure of functional autonomy and independence as the Union Public Service Commission (UPSC)
